As a Canadian diplomat in the early 1960s Scott was privy to communications that clearly demonstrated American bad faith in the run-up to the war in Vietnam.Scott could see that the US was working to subvert the Geneva Accords that had ended French involvement in SE Asia from the get-go.
This revelation inspired in Professor Scott a career of research into the field to which he gave the name “deep politics”.His work in turn inspired English researcher Robin Ramsay to publish Lobster the six-monthly intelligence journal that made parapolitics its special province.
